SBI investigating suspicious death in Bridgeton

SBI investigating suspicious death in Bridgeton after body found on Tuesday, April 30.{p}{/p}BRIDGETON, Craven County —A death investigation is currently ongoing after a body was found on Tuesday, April 30 in Craven County. Law enforcement responded to B Street in Bridgeton after receiving a call around 2:00 p.m. from the girlfriend, according to Captain Johnson with the Bridgeton Police Department. Read MorePolice say a person was found deceased once authorities arrived on scene. The identity has not been released at this time. The SBI is handling the investigation, which is considered a suspicious death. The Craven County Sheriff’s Office assisted the Bridgeton Police Department with…

Ripple signs SBI, HashKey to launch XRP in Japan

SBI Group is set to become the first Japanese corporation to implement XRP Ledger (XRPL) blockchain solutions for supply chain management. The alliance comes as Ripple expands the use of enterprise blockchain solutions in Japan. Separately, Ripple has teamed up with the Tokyo-based consulting firm HashKey DX to lead the rollout of XRPL enterprise solutions in Japan. The partnership will also involve SBI Ripple Asia, a joint venture between SBI Holdings and Ripple, which will focus on developing supply chain finance solutions using the XRPL blockchain.Andy Dan, head of HashKey DX, said: “The XRPL was the ideal blockchain infrastructure for us to build our proven supply chain finance…

Delhi High Court grants relief to 1.8 crore SBI credit card holders

SBI In a major relief to nearly 1.8 crore credit card holders, the Delhi High Court recently restrained a company named Kony, Inc from disrupting the IT services offered to SBI Cards and Payment Services Private Limited.Justice Prathiba M Singh passed an ex-parte ad interim order on April 26 and said that considering the nature of services which SBI Cards and Payment Services Private Limited (petitioner) is providing, any apprehension that the software license could be disrupted, would result in enormous risks to customers.The Court, therefore, restrained Kony or anyone acting on its behalf from taking any action or steps, which would result in the disruption in the credit card…

SBI Securities highlights the similarities between cricket and investments, ET BrandEquity

A still from the adSBI Securities, a financial services firm, has launched its first campaign this IPL season, which brings out the similarities between cricket and investment. The campaign, #PlayItRight underlines the right investment practices through a series of five films.The campaign story revolves around a group of five friends, who are young investors, and have come together to enjoy cricket matches, conveying investing lessons to the audience through their conversations. Through a series of five films, SBI Securities has taken a unique approach to educate young investors. The fundamentals of cricket are seen as an analogy for the…

State Bank of India Launches Travel Credit Card

Skift Take
While there are several co-branded credit cards offered by airlines and hotels, banks releasing travel-focused core credit cards indicates a shift in consumer preference and the rising popularity of travel credit cards in India.
— Bulbul Dhawan

India’s largest bank State Bank of India (SBI) has launched its first-ever travel focused credit card. ‘SBI Card MILES’ has been launched in three variants to cater to different types of travelers, from beginners to frequent flyers.

Nifty Bank rallies over 1,000 points, hits new high; Axis, ICICI Bank & SBI scale fresh 52-week highs

The Nifty Bank bounced back on Monday with gains of over 2% to hit a fresh record high above 49,400 levels for the first time.The Nifty Bank rose 1,223 points to close at 49,424, while the Nifty50 advanced over 200 points to close at 22,643.During the day, the banking benchmark scaled a fresh record high of 49,473. ICICI Bank, Axis Bank, and SBI also hit fresh 52-week highs in intraday trade.AU Small Finance Bank closed with gains of over 6%, while ICICI Bank gained more than 4% and SBI ended over 3% higher. Mild profit booking was seen in Bandhan Bank and IDFC First Bank.Buyers dominated the market today as the whole trading day we saw very shallow corrections and any such minor…
